  • In this video we’ll show how to make an ARRI Alexa 35 accept external Timceode and Genlock.
    Turn on all your Lockit devices, choose one of them to be the Master Clock - then press-and-hold the green button to broadcast timecode and framerate through ACN and you are set.
    Make sure that all cameras and Lockit Devices run on the same frame rate.
    - Lockit: press green and red simultaneously to enter menu, then and navigate to “Project Rate”
    - Camera:
    - Enter Menu
    - Go to “Recording”
    - Go to “Project Settings”
    - Adjust “Project Rate”
    How to make the camera accept external Timecode:
    - Tap on the “TC” area on the display
    - Go to “Options”
    - As “Run Mode” select “Free Run”
    - As “Mode” select “Regen”
    For this camera you need an TC-IO Timecode cable.
    Connect it to the LEMO Timecode Connector
    Now the camera accepts the external Timecode source.
    If your setup requires Genlock, you can use the same setup. ARRI cameras can lock their sensor to an accurate Timecode Input via Lockits.
    How to make the camera accept external Genlock signal:
    - Enter Menu
    - Go to “System”
    - Go to “Sensor”
    - As “Genlock Sync” select “TC IN”
